Instagram’s Sharing Mechanisms

Instagram provides several intuitive ways to share posts, catering to different user preferences. You can share posts to your Stories directly, which allows for a wider reach since Stories appear at the top of user feeds. Alternatively, you can even copy a link to the post and share it outside of Instagram, enhancing cross-platform engagement. Here are the primary methods you can use to share posts:

  • Sharing to Stories: Tap the share icon on a post, select “Add post to your story,” and customize it with stickers or text before sharing.
  • Direct Messaging: Choose the direct message option to share a post privately with friends or specific users.
  • Copy Link: By selecting “Copy Link,” you can share the post on other platforms, like Twitter or Facebook, broadening its accessibility.

When it comes to understanding whether someone has shared your content, Instagram doesn’t notify users directly. However, if someone engages with your content via a Story and mentions you, you may see engagement through direct messages or mentions. Utilizing features such as Instagram Insights can help track how your posts are performing and whether they’ve attracted shares by evaluating metrics such as impressions, reach, and interactions.

Analyze Your Insights

To start monitoring engagement, navigate to your Instagram Insights, which is available for business and creator accounts. Here’s how to access and utilize these insights effectively:

  • Go to your Profile: Tap the profile icon at the bottom right corner of the app.
  • Open Insights: Tap on the three horizontal lines at the top right, then select ‘Insights’.
  • Engagement Metrics: Review key metrics such as impressions, reach, and engagement rate. Get a breakdown of your posts’ performance over a specific time frame.

Within the Insights menu, you can also view detailed stats for each post. This data can highlight which content encourages your followers to engage the most, allowing you to optimize future posts.

Engagement Rate Calculation

Understanding your engagement rate is vital to measuring the effectiveness of your content. You can calculate it using the formula:

Total Engagements Post Reach Engagement Rate (%)
Likes + Comments + Saves Number of unique users who saw the post (Total Engagements / Post Reach) x 100

By frequently monitoring this metric, you can spot trends over time, such as specific content types or posting times that yield greater engagement.

Instagram’s Sharing Mechanics
Unlike platforms that provide detailed insights into shared content, Instagram operates differently. When someone shares your post, whether through direct messages or on their own stories, you do not receive a notification or have access to a list of accounts that have shared it. This is by design to maintain user privacy. Therefore, you might be left guessing who your post reached beyond your immediate followers.

What You Can See

While you cannot see who has specifically shared your post, you can gain insights on engagement and reach through Instagram’s analytics tools if you have a business or creator account. This includes metrics like likes, comments, and views on your content. These analytics can help you gauge how well your content is performing overall, even if they don’t break down who specifically shared it.

  • Story Shares: If someone shares your post in their story, their followers may see it, but you cannot track who saw your story.
  • Direct Messages: Sharing via DM is completely private, and you won’t know if someone forwarded your post this way.
